Only a small patch (version 1.2) this time around; 5.58megs to be exact, but there’s plenty of helpful tweaks to the gameplay to help clean up this decent strategy title. Patch notes below as well as a download link. DOWNLOAD HERE OFF OUR SERVER. - Armies whose morale collapses in the first 5 days and face more than double the amount of enemies will now be eliminated.
- Battles should now be a fair bit more bloody.
- Failing an assault increases morale of defenders now.
- Morale of defenders now recover every month during a siege.
- Troops will no longer reinforce in empty provinces.
- Reinforcing at lack of supply line to a friendly occupied city is now only 10% of normal speed.
- Reinforcing adjacent to friendly occupied, but at hostile territory is halved.
- It’s now slower to land into enemy territory, but also faster to land into controlled territory.
- Loyal troops are now cheaper to maintain as their commander will pay some of their cost.
- Increased basic force limits.
